Mary Trump spent much of her childhood in her grandparents' house in the heart of Queens, New York, where Donald and his four siblings grew up. She describes a nightmare of traumas, destructive relationships, and a tragic combination of neglect and abuse. As a trained clinical psychologist, she explains how specific events and general family patterns created the damaged man who currently occupies the Oval Office, including the strange and harmful...

Former Director of Communications for the Office of Public Liaison in the Trump administration, Omarosa Manigault Newman discusses how her personal and professional relationships with Donald Trump have changed from the time she was a contestant on "The Apprentice" to her public ousting from White House.

A sportswriter's indictment of how Trump's golf habits reflect his off-the-course ethics draws on personal experience and witness interviews to reveal how Trump lies, intimidates, and files lawsuits to get away with rampant cheating.

In a new memoir, the U.S. ambassador to the Ukraine, whose life and work have taught her the preciousness of democracy as well as the dangers of corruption, details her involvement in President Trump's impeachment inquiry and her response to his smear campaign.

A White House reporter traces Steve Bannon's path to Breitbart, the White House, and back to Breitbart, discussing his role in the 2016 presidential election, his relationships with others in the Trump administration, and his plans for the future.
